Transaction 75adeca37c6ebfa672746bf4477df99ca2da13d8a7a5fca990666f896bb72551

1 Input
2 Outputs
  • 75adeca37c6ebfa672746bf4477df99ca2da13d8a7a5fca990666f896bb72551:0
  • value  631651
    address  32R1WBUxV2F9vowx9152SfuGbdhayjPPDU
  • 75adeca37c6ebfa672746bf4477df99ca2da13d8a7a5fca990666f896bb72551:1
  • value  195183598
    address  393Ucnpa65nTG5DxCu3gaERqy3dJEDwvNW